Doe Camp Nation is a vibrant community of women committed to fostering new friendships and exciting adventures while acquiring valuable outdoor skills. With the support of dedicated instructors, volunteers, and generous business sponsors, we empower women to broaden their horizons and pursue their passions in the great outdoors. As a volunteer-led, member-driven, non-profit organization, we provide women with access to a wide array of outdoor resources and services.

Through the continued support of local and national businesses and organizations, we are proud to achieve the following goals:

  • Offer high-quality, outdoor recreation-based learning experiences at accessible prices

  • Build participants' self-confidence in a welcoming and supportive environment

  • Facilitate connections among women with shared interests for encouragement, networking, and lasting friendships

  • Foster a lifelong passion for outdoor activities

  • Advocate for a stronger, more informed female voice in the management and conservation of natural resources

At Doe Camp Nation, we are dedicated to creating opportunities that inspire women to embrace the outdoors and take an active role in shaping the future of our natural world.

Doe Camp Nation invites all adventurous women (18 and older) to join us for Fall Doe Camp, happening September 11–13, 2026, at Jackson’s Lodge in Canaan, Vermont. Fall Doe Camp offers a unique opportunity for women to connect, build lasting relationships, and develop new skills in a supportive and inspiring environment. Participants can explore a variety of activities, including:

* Biking * Camping * Hiking *

* Shooting * Hunting   *

* Crafts, hobbies * Archery, and so much more!

Our mission is to empower women of all ages and abilities to participate in outdoor activities through hands-on education. Whether you're a seasoned outdoor enthusiast or a curious beginner, there's something for everyone at Doe Camp.

Registration Cost



Registration cost is dependent on lodging option and includes lodging, 5 catered meals, classes and materials.


  • Cabin $475

  • Tent/RV $400

  • Local - no housing  $250
